Interested in exploring the scene from a distance? Virtual webcam streams have become increasingly common for delivering a immediate glimpse into situations around the globe. This article will to explain the https://zoyaijmt868130.bmswiki.com/6171175/virtual_broadcast_shows_a_explanation_to_internet_streaming